Hallo,
bei der Installation des DVB Treibers "v4l-DVB" (hg clone http://linuxtv.org/hg/v4l-dvb) bekomme ich bei "make" folgende Meldung:
Code
linux-vdr3:/usr/local/src/vdr_hd_files/DVB # make
make -C /usr/local/src/vdr_hd_files/v4l-dvb/v4l
make[1]: Entering directory `/usr/local/src/vdr_hd_files/v4l-dvb/v4l'
scripts/make_makefile.pl
./scripts/make_myconfig.pl
make[1]: Leaving directory `/usr/local/src/vdr_hd_files/v4l-dvb/v4l'
make[1]: Entering directory `/usr/local/src/vdr_hd_files/v4l-dvb/v4l'
perl scripts/make_config_compat.pl /lib/modules/2.6.37.6-0.5-desktop/source ./.myconfig ./config-compat.h
creating symbolic links...
ln -sf . oss
make -C firmware prep
make[2]: Entering directory `/usr/local/src/vdr_hd_files/v4l-dvb/v4l/firmware'
make[2]: Leaving directory `/usr/local/src/vdr_hd_files/v4l-dvb/v4l/firmware'
make -C firmware
make[2]: Entering directory `/usr/local/src/vdr_hd_files/v4l-dvb/v4l/firmware'
CC ihex2fw
Generating vicam/firmware.fw
Generating dabusb/firmware.fw
Generating dabusb/bitstream.bin
Generating ttusb-budget/dspbootcode.bin
Generating cpia2/stv0672_vp4.bin
Generating av7110/bootcode.bin
make[2]: Leaving directory `/usr/local/src/vdr_hd_files/v4l-dvb/v4l/firmware'
Kernel build directory is /lib/modules/2.6.37.6-0.5-desktop/build
make -C /lib/modules/2.6.37.6-0.5-desktop/build SUBDIRS=/usr/local/src/vdr_hd_files/v4l-dvb/v4l modules
make[2]: Entering directory `/usr/src/linux-2.6.37.6-0.5-obj/x86_64/desktop'
make -C ../../../linux-2.6.37.6-0.5 O=/usr/src/linux-2.6.37.6-0.5-obj/x86_64/desktop/. modules
CC [M] /usr/local/src/vdr_hd_files/v4l-dvb/v4l/tuner-xc2028.o
CC [M] /usr/local/src/vdr_hd_files/v4l-dvb/v4l/tuner-simple.o
CC [M] /usr/local/src/vdr_hd_files/v4l-dvb/v4l/tuner-types.o
CC [M] /usr/local/src/vdr_hd_files/v4l-dvb/v4l/mt20xx.o
CC [M] /usr/local/src/vdr_hd_files/v4l-dvb/v4l/tda8290.o
CC [M] /usr/local/src/vdr_hd_files/v4l-dvb/v4l/tea5767.o
CC [M] /usr/local/src/vdr_hd_files/v4l-dvb/v4l/tea5761.o
CC [M] /usr/local/src/vdr_hd_files/v4l-dvb/v4l/tda9887.o
CC [M] /usr/local/src/vdr_hd_files/v4l-dvb/v4l/tda827x.o
CC [M] /usr/local/src/vdr_hd_files/v4l-dvb/v4l/au0828-core.o
CC [M] /usr/local/src/vdr_hd_files/v4l-dvb/v4l/au0828-i2c.o
CC [M] /usr/local/src/vdr_hd_files/v4l-dvb/v4l/au0828-cards.o
CC [M] /usr/local/src/vdr_hd_files/v4l-dvb/v4l/au0828-dvb.o
CC [M] /usr/local/src/vdr_hd_files/v4l-dvb/v4l/au0828-video.o
CC [M] /usr/local/src/vdr_hd_files/v4l-dvb/v4l/au0828-vbi.o
CC [M] /usr/local/src/vdr_hd_files/v4l-dvb/v4l/au8522_dig.o
CC [M] /usr/local/src/vdr_hd_files/v4l-dvb/v4l/au8522_decoder.o
CC [M] /usr/local/src/vdr_hd_files/v4l-dvb/v4l/flexcop-pci.o
CC [M] /usr/local/src/vdr_hd_files/v4l-dvb/v4l/flexcop-usb.o
CC [M] /usr/local/src/vdr_hd_files/v4l-dvb/v4l/flexcop.o
CC [M] /usr/local/src/vdr_hd_files/v4l-dvb/v4l/flexcop-fe-tuner.o
CC [M] /usr/local/src/vdr_hd_files/v4l-dvb/v4l/flexcop-i2c.o
/usr/local/src/vdr_hd_files/v4l-dvb/v4l/flexcop-i2c.c: In function 'flexcop_i2c_init':
/usr/local/src/vdr_hd_files/v4l-dvb/v4l/flexcop-i2c.c:253:39: error: 'I2C_CLASS_TV_DIGITAL' undeclared (first use in this function)
/usr/local/src/vdr_hd_files/v4l-dvb/v4l/flexcop-i2c.c:253:39: note: each undeclared identifier is reported only once for each function it appears in
make[5]: *** [/usr/local/src/vdr_hd_files/v4l-dvb/v4l/flexcop-i2c.o] Error 1
make[4]: *** [_module_/usr/local/src/vdr_hd_files/v4l-dvb/v4l] Error 2
make[3]: *** [sub-make] Error 2
make[2]: *** [all] Error 2
make[2]: Leaving directory `/usr/src/linux-2.6.37.6-0.5-obj/x86_64/desktop'
make[1]: *** [default] Error 2
make[1]: Leaving directory `/usr/local/src/vdr_hd_files/v4l-dvb/v4l'
make: *** [all] Error 2
Alles anzeigen
openSUSE 11.4: Kernel = 2.6.37.6-0.5-desktop
MfG
Jürgen B.